Generated summary AI-assisted

The source text indicates this attachment appears to be a draft document.

The memorandum from Councilmember Bien Doan outlines recommendations for retroactive approval of dumpster days as City Council-sponsored special events in various neighborhoods. It includes events held on May 17 and May 24, 2025, and upcoming events on June 21 and June 28, 2025. The memorandum seeks approval for expenditures and acceptance of donations for these events.

Key points
  • Retroactive approval for dumpster days in Rocksprings and Tropicana-Lanai Neighborhoods on May 17 and May 24, 2025.
  • Approval for upcoming dumpster days in West Evergreen and Montecito Vista Neighborhoods on June 21 and June 28, 2025.
  • Recommendation to accept donations from individuals, businesses, or community groups supporting the events.
  • Compliance with prior City Council direction regarding special events.
  • Public outreach through posting on the City’s website for the Rules Committee and City Council agendas.

RULES COMMITTEE AGENDA: 6/11/25 ITEM: B.10 TO: HONORABLE MAYOR AND CITY COUNCIL SUBJECT: SEE BELOW FROM: Councilmember Bien Doan DATE: June 04, 2025 APPROVED: SUBJECT: RETROACTIVE APPROVAL AND APPROVAL OF MULTIPLE SPECIAL EVENTS SPONSORED BY COUNCIL DISTRICT 7 AS CITY COUNCIL SPONSORED SPECIAL EVENTS TO EXPEND CITY FUNDS AND ACCEPT DONATIONS OF MATERIALS AND SERVICES FOR THE EVENTS. RECOMMENDATION 1. Retroactively approve the dumpster day in the Rocksprings Neighborhood, on May 17, 2025, as a City Council-sponsored Special Event and approve the expenditure of funds. 2. Retroactively approve the dumpster day in the Tropicana-Lanai Neighborhood, on May 24, 2025, as a City Council-sponsored Special Event and approve the expenditure of funds. 3. Approve the dumpster day in the West Evergreen Neighborhood, on June 21, 2025, as a City Council-sponsored Special Event and approve the expenditure of funds. 4. Approve the dumpster day in the Montecito Vista Neighborhood, on June 28, 2025, as a City Council-sponsored Special Event and approve the expenditure of funds. 5.
